Transaction e8cfea1384adadde9923461ae67eeae8f509a2c176758700115fe8b9a54d8a61
1 Input
1 Output
-
e8cfea1384adadde9923461ae67eeae8f509a2c176758700115fe8b9a54d8a61:0
- value
- 162503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79543140ee1f051b0533ce49ade156669da31588 OP_EQUAL
- address
- 3CkYYYbRYcJyRxWKVdwAzQqHfRmXFoVkYa